Thread Counting System And Their Application

Thread Counting System

In the fabric manufacturing process, thread selection is important to get the proper GSM of a fabric. Generally, when the consumption of fabric is done then it is fixed how much yarn will be used in fabric production. Basically, after producing a fabric, thread per inch in warp and weft direction is measured to be confirmed the number of warp and weft yarn in the fabric.

Thread Counting System and Their Application

Various types of thread counting systems are generally used to measure the number of threads in the warp and weft direction of a fabric. The Following are the most used system of thread counting. They are-

Counting glass/Pick glass:

It is the most used method of thread counting. In this system, counting glass is placed on the fabric surface and thread is counted manually by a pin. It can be used to count course per inch and Wales per inch of a knitted fabric. It is a widely used method and a very handy method.

Traversing thread counter:

Its measuring system is similar to pick glass but it somewhat improved instrument where the counting pin is moved by means of a handle. It is used for measuring the EPI, PPI, CPI, and WPI of a fabric.

Fabric dissection method:

In this method, the fabric is cut for doing this measurement. It is a most authentic and reliable thread counting method. This counting method is used where the thread of the fabric is difficult to count by the others measuring system.

Taper grating and line rating:

This type of thread measuring system is used where-

  • The test results are required in a short time.
  • Where a large number of fabric samples are required to test in a very short time.
  • Where the exact test result is unimportant rather a good approximation is required.
  • Normally fashion designers use this type of instrument.

The thread counting system is an offline quality assurance system. We can measure the thread of the fabric using the above measuring system.
